Kanye West & Nicki Minaj Rule the Chart

Kanye West and Nicki Minaj are the king and queen of Billboard. The hip-hop titans outperformed the competition last week, earning the top two spots on the albums chart.

West’s critically-acclaimed fifth album My Beautiful Dark Twisted Fantasy debuts at No. 1 on the Billboard 200 with 496,000 copies sold in its first week, according to final figures released by Billboard. This is his fourth straight No. 1 album following 2008’s 808s & Heartbreak.

Not to be overshadowed by her “Monster” collaborator, Nicki Minaj put up her own impressive numbers as her debut Pink Friday comes in second place with 375,000. This gives her the second highest one-week sales by a female hip-hop act since Lauryn Hill, who holds the record with 423,000 units sold of 1998’s The Miseducation of Lauryn Hill.

You can’t stop Bieber fever. Justin Bieber’s Walmart and Sam’s Club-exclusive set, My Worlds Acoustic, comes in at No. 7 with 115,000, giving him his third top 10 album in a little over a year.

Ne-Yo’s Libra Scale rounds out the top 10 at No. 9 with 112,000 copies, falling short of the opening week sales of his previous three offerings. Lloyd Banks’ H.F.M. 2 (The Hunger for More 2) eats up 44,000 units to enter at No. 25, while Ke$ha’s Cannibal devours the No. 15 spot (74,000).

Many releases were expected to see a boost during the Black Friday shopping weekend, but didn’t meet initial projections.
